Plyometric exercises are explosive movements that involve rapid contractions of muscles, followed by quick relaxation. These exercises work by stretching and shortening the muscles in quick succession, which increases the force and speed of contractions.
Common examples of plyometric exercises include box jumps, squat jumps, and lunges with explosive jumps. These exercises typically involve jumping, hopping, or bounding movements, and are designed to improve power and explosiveness in athletes.
The science behind plyometric exercises is based on the principle of the stretch-shortening cycle. This refers to the rapid contraction of muscles that occurs after a rapid stretch. When a muscle is lengthened before a contraction, it stores elastic energy that is released during the subsequent contraction. This means that you can produce more force and power during the contraction.
The stretch-shortening cycle is essential in plyometric exercises, as it allows you to perform explosive movements with greater speed and power. Plyometric exercises train your muscles to respond quickly to the elastic energy stored during the stretch phase, which can improve performance in sports such as basketball, volleyball, and sprinting.
Plyometric exercises offer a wide range of benefits for individuals looking to improve their fitness levels. These benefits include:
Improved power and explosiveness: Plyometric exercises train the muscles to produce greater force and speed during contractions, which can improve power and explosiveness in sports.
Increased calorie burn: Plyometric exercises involve high-intensity movements that can burn a significant amount of calories in a short period of time.
Better coordination and balance: Plyometric exercises require coordination and balance, which can improve your overall motor skills.
Reduced risk of injury: Plyometric exercises can help improve joint stability and reduce the risk of injury in sports.
Before incorporating plyometric exercises into your workout routine, it is important to ensure that you have a good level of fitness and strength. Plyometric exercises are high-intensity movements that can be challenging for beginners.
Start by incorporating one or two plyometric exercises into your workout routine, and gradually increase the number and intensity of the exercises as you become fitter and stronger. Remember to warm up properly before performing plyometric exercises, and to rest and recover adequately between workouts.
